Fairly Made: Revolutionizing Sustainability in the Fashion Industry

Fairly Made, a French start-up founded by Laure Betsch and Camille Le Gal, is making waves in the fashion industry by assisting brands in their transition to sustainability. The company collaborates with renowned fashion brands like SMCP and LVMH, as well as independent labels, to help them improve their purchasing practices and become more environmentally and socially responsible.

The founders of Fairly Made have extensive experience working in the buying departments of major fashion companies such as Chanel, H&M, and Louis Vuitton. This firsthand experience has allowed them to understand the needs of brands and identify the gaps in sustainability practices within the industry.

When Fairly Made was established in 2018, environmental concerns were just starting to gain traction in the fashion industry. The start-up initially created capsule collections with a more sustainable approach to raise awareness and provide practical solutions for brands. A notable early success was their collaboration with Des Petits Hauts, assisting the brand in taking its initial steps towards responsible sourcing in 2019.

Fairly Made offers brands a comprehensive solution for tracing their entire value chain and evaluating the environmental, social, traceability, recyclability, and sustainability aspects of their products. In partnership with DNVB Asphalte and women’s fashion brand Des Petits Hauts, the company developed its own platform to collect and analyze information from brands and their suppliers.

By centralizing and analyzing data, Fairly Made helps brands identify areas with the most significant impact and guides their efforts in improving sustainability practices. The company places emphasis on a software-as-a-service (SaaS) solution that provides brands with direct access to their data, transformation plans, and performance metrics.

As customer awareness and scrutiny around greenwashing practices grow, the demand for sustainability in the fashion industry is increasing. Regulatory bodies are also implementing measures to enforce transparency and environmental labeling. Fairly Made supports brands in meeting these requirements and staying ahead of regulatory changes.

In addition to its platform, Fairly Made offers tools for brands to communicate the origin and life cycle of their products to customers. QR codes on labels or widgets enable brands to enhance their products’ potential and extend their lifecycle in the second-hand market.

With a growing client roster of approximately 50 brands in France and Europe, Fairly Made is experiencing rapid growth. The company plans to expand its team from a dozen employees to around thirty by the end of 2022. To support its expansion and continue developing its methodology, which now encompasses textiles, leather, metalwork, and woodwork, Fairly Made aims to raise three million euros in its next funding round.
